Classic films and tasty food to rock Warwick
Activities will get underway from 6.30pm on Saturday, August 29, when the bars and streetfood will begin serving ahead of the outdoor screening of Back to the Future at 7.30pm.
The action on the Sunday gets underway at midday with the build up to a screening of the Pixar family favourite Toy Story, which will be followed at 3pm by Steven Spielberg’s dinosaur adventure Jurassic Park.

Hide AdThe festival will end with a screening of the first Indiana Jones film, Raiders of the Lost Ark, from 6pm.
Organisers are advising visitors to take a chair or picnic blanket, as well as warm clothing.
The Warwick Rocks Food and Film Festival also has an array of delights from some of the nation’s top streetfood providers, in addition to the Pimms Bar, Little Gin Company and Big Red Bus Bar!
A spokesperson for organisers Warwick Rocks said: “This event and all the others we are putting on in Warwick this year is down to the amazing businesses and people of the town. Thanks to the support of individuals and businesses we smashed through our £10,000 crowd funder target in April, raising £10,060.”
